Well I pulled my boat again and I was thinking how much its like Christmas. The Spring...raising the mast for launch is like putting up the tree. Excited about whats ahead, and a holiday that lasts (at least every weekend) for the entire summer. Then dropping the mast and pulling in the fall. Its just like that blah feeling you get taking your Christmas tree down. Unlike Christmas at least I don't have to wait an entire year to "put the tree up" again!

John,
We have been using Conch Charters...also in Road Town...getting 50' Beneteaus. Conch Charters boats are a bit older than Moorings...but everything always works perfectly and the savings are dramatic. Gotta start at Willie T's...make sure you hit the Baths, and if you can pull it off...get to Anegada. When you arrive, put your order in immediately for a BBQ lobster for that evening..its unbelievable! My favorite place to have a Pain Killer or Pina Colada is the Soggy Dollar on Jost. If you are there for the full moon..hit the party at Bombas Shack! Yeehaaaa!
